Just announced by Aggro Crab (PEAK, Another Crab’s Treasure) is the insanely cool looking Rebounder.
What exactly is it? Rebounder is a precision-platformer that draws inspiration from vintage sci-fi comics, zines, and the world of physical print. Also made as a love-letter to games like speedrunners to provide a fast-paced challenge but remain approachable to different types of gamers.
From the press release sent to GamingOnLinux: when the team at ThirtyThree showed Rebounder to Aggro Crab, they were hooked. People who are a fan of Aggro Crab’s work will feel right at home with the fast-paced gameplay and unique style that make Rebounder stand out. “It’s been awesome working with Aggro Crab. They totally understand our vision for the game, and as fellow devs, they know the subtleties of getting it right.” said Logan Gilmour, a co-founder of ThirtyThree.

Key Features
- 500+ hand-crafted screens of trick-shot platforming.
- 6 distinct chapters across an unforgiving worksite, packed with hidden, extra-tough challenges if you go looking.
- An immersive story that will keep you guessing until the end (and after.).
- Fast respawns, unlimited tries. Nail the perfect run, as many lives as it takes.
- A multitude of accessibility options to cover players of all skill levels.
- Expressive vibes with pulpy art and comic-book inspired world.

In the same email to GamingOnLinux, Aggro Crab also noted they’re taking on more indie developers looking for publisher support.
“PEAK’s success put us in a unique position. We weren’t really interested in significantly growing the size of our team, but we were interested in growing our catalog.” said Corey Warning, Head of Publishing at Aggro Crab. “We like to be hands-on with the projects we’re working with, we can offer some unique perspectives and feedback to games from our background as indie developers and our experience self-publishing. We’ve also grown a massive community over the years who trust our approach to how we make and promote our own games.”
Aggro Crab are looking for projects that need $500k or less to get across the finish line inside of 2 years or less, and are prioritizing intense, stylized games with an attitude. “We don’t have any specific genres we’re locked into, we’re generally looking for games that fit the vibe of the Aggro Crab catalog, and stuff that we think will resonate well with our audience. And no generative AI slop.”
